Entry into force notes
This Decree-Law enters into force on the day after its publication and takes effect from 1 January 2021.
Résumé

This Decree-Law approves the the Statute of the General Fisheries Inspection Staff (IGP). This Statute, consisting of 57 articles divided into six Chapters and four Annexes, establishes the principles, rules and criteria for the organization, structuring and development of careers and professional positions of inspectors of the General Fisheries Inspection. This Statute applies to all Fisheries Inspectors, namely fisheries inspectors and health inspectors, regardless of their functions in the areas of inspection of the legality of fishing activities or sanitary inspection of fishery products. In addition, the Statute aims at promoting the professional development of IGP staff, and ensuring a rational and optimized management of human resources and guarantee the full use of available staff.
